Romans 15:8-16

Devotionals, Articles, and Bible Study Resources on Romans 15:8-16

8For I tell you that Christ has become a servant of the circumcised on behalf of God’s truth, to confirm the promises made to the patriarchs,
9so that the Gentiles may glorify God for His mercy. As it is written:
“Therefore I will praise You among the Gentiles;
I will sing hymns to Your name.”
10Again, it says:
“Rejoice, O Gentiles, with His people.”
11And again:
“Praise the Lord, all you Gentiles,
and extol Him, all you peoples.”
12And once more, Isaiah says:
“The Root of Jesse will appear,
One who will arise to rule over the Gentiles;
in Him the Gentiles will put their hope.”
13Now may the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ace as you believe in Him, so that you may overflow with hope by the power of the Holy Spirit.
14I myself am convinced, my brothers, that you yourselves are full of goodness, brimming with knowledge, and able to instruct one another.
15However, I have written you a bold reminder on some points, because of the grace God has given me
16to be a minister of Christ Jesus to the Gentiles in the priestly service of the gospel of God, so that the Gentiles might become an offering acceptable to God, sanctified by the Holy Spirit.
— Romans 15:8-16
